Hi Georges, Those are normally invisible files that the MacOS puts on a volume. I suspect that your flash media is formatted as MSDOS so no matter how many times you get rid of them, they'll simply reappear. It's just a translation thing. The only way to permanently make them invisible is to format your flash media as a Mac partition.
